Job Description
Enterprise Business Development Manager – ITAM, Software Advisory
Connor
• Drive net-new logo acquisition across enterprise, government, and BFSI accounts • Own greenfield account development from initial engagement through multi-year managed services contracts • Convert advisory and tooling engagements into recurring managed optimisation services • Build and execute territory and account plans aligned to annuity revenue growth • Manage the full enterprise sales cycle: prospecting, discovery, solution positioning, proposal, negotiation, and close • Lead consultative discovery focused on cost optimisation, compliance risk, audit exposure, and operational efficiency • Build senior stakeholder relationships across IT, Procurement, Finance, Security, Risk, and Audit • Collaborate with presales, consulting, and delivery teams to shape differentiated advisory solutions • Engage with technology partners and system integrators on joint pursuits • Maintain accurate CRM data and participate in pipeline and forecast reviews
Job Requirements
- 8–10 years of enterprise B2B IT services or advisory sales experience (GCC preferred)
- Proven success in net-new logo acquisition and consultative services selling
- Experience selling to large enterprises, government organisations, or BFSI customers
- Strong exposure to ITAM / SAM, ServiceNow, Flexera, Snow, or similar platforms
- Track record managing enterprise deal sizes typically ranging from USD 200K to USD 1M+
- Strong discovery, value articulation, and business-case selling capability
